“Unleashing data: Journalists' pursuit of open information and accountability” - iMEdD International Journalism Forum 2023

This panel, held on September 30, 2023, as part of the International Journalism Forum 2023 hosted by iMEdD in Athens, features data journalists and investigative reporters from different corners of the world with the aim of providing a comprehensive analysis of the current state of open data accessibility. Within this context, the panelists delve into how public institutions respond to the demands for information disclosure. They also scrutinize the challenges faced by journalists in their pursuit of data and examine various strategies and initiatives that can compel governments to share crucial information with the public. In essence, the panel aims to offer an in-depth exploration of open data issues on a global scale.
